Job vacancy: Residence Manager (Summer Camps 2023)

Job role:
You will be working with the summer management team to deliver an exceptional experience to our students. A live-in position that sees you have the overall responsibility for a hotel/residence and the students/staff who are staying there.

You will support a team of international leaders to ensure our students have a Home Away from Home experience. You will take care of room allocation, supervise a team of leaders and ensure the hotel staff work in harmony with your team. You will liaise with hotel owners and staff on anything from cleaning to theme events and safety.  A truly memorable experience, you will interact with staff and students from across the world daily.

Requirements:

  • Must be a team player that can lead from the front.
  • Outgoing and great attention to detail.
  • Able to take responsibility naturally.
  • Cope well under pressure.
  • Legally able to work in Malta, have a Maltese/EU passport or a work permit.
  • Speak at least C1 English.

Details:
  • Roles are available for 4-12 weeks during June, July & August. For shorter durations, it could be combined with a leader or teacher role before or after.
  • 6-day per week full-time contracts.
  • Accommodation included.

About EF Education First:
At EF we believe that the world is better when people try to understand one another. Since 1965, we have helped millions of people see new places, experience new cultures, and learn new things about the world and about themselves. Our culturally immersive education programs—focused on language, travel, cultural exchange, and academics—turn dreams into international opportunities. When you join EF, you join a multicultural and diverse community working across more than 600 schools and offices in 50 countries, all with one shared mission of opening the world through education.
